区块链技术的迅速发展,使得数字资产的管理变得愈发重要。在这个过程中,区块链钱包作为用户存储和管理数字资产的主要工具,其重要性自是毋庸置疑。而随着移动互联网的普及,H5应用因其跨平台的特性和良好的用户体验,成为了大家追逐的热点。H5区块链钱包不仅可以方便用户随时随地管理自己的资产,还能吸引更多用户参与到区块链生态中。
### H5区块链钱包源码概述在开始之前,我们需要理解H5区块链钱包源码的基本结构。通常情况下,这类源码是由前端与后端两大部分组成。前端部分负责用户界面的呈现,而后端部分则负责数据存储与逻辑处理。此外,开发环境通常选用JavaScript、HTML5和CSS3等流行的网页开发技术,以确保兼容性和易用性。
开发工具方面,可以使用Visual Studio Code、Sublime Text等热门编辑器进行源码编写。Node.js作为后端开发的优秀框架,结合Express框架,能够快速搭建起服务端应用。在此基础上,我们还需要引入区块链相关的SDK,例如Web3.js,以实现与区块链的交互。
### 搭建H5区块链钱包的步骤 #### 第一步:环境准备在开始搭建H5区块链钱包之前,我们需要确认开发环境的搭建。这包括安装Node.js、npm以及其他依赖项。确保环境正常后,可以通过npm来安装所需的软件包。
#### 第二步:源码下载与配置将所需的H5区块链钱包源码下载到本地,解压缩后进行必要的配置。配置文件通常包括区块链节点的地址、智能合约相关信息等,需要根据实际情况进行调整。
#### 第三步:前端与后台的整合前端与后端的整合是搭建过程中最重要的一步。需要将前端页面中的请求发送到后端API,以获取资产信息、交易历史等数据。此处可使用AJAX技术实现异步请求,提升用户体验。
#### 第四步:测试与上线完成基本功能后,进行全面的测试是十分必要的。确保钱包的安全性、稳定性和流畅性。此后即可将项目上线,让更多用户体验这一便捷的H5钱包。
### H5区块链钱包的功能特点 #### 安全性安全性是区块链钱包的第一要务。H5钱包需要对用户的私钥进行严格保护,最好支持离线签名交易。此外,引入多重认证机制,可有效降低被盗风险。
#### 用户友好性良好的用户体验能够吸引更多用户使用钱包。H5钱包在设计时应简化操作流程,方便用户进行资产管理。而且,提供详细的使用指南和顾客服务,是提升用户满意度的重要措施。
#### 扩展性H5钱包的架构设计应该遵循开放的原则,以支持后续功能的扩展。无论是增加新币种还是其他功能模块,都应尽量做到无缝集成。
### 成功案例分析 #### 具体案例简介例如某知名的H5钱包,在上线后短短数月内便吸引了数十万用户。其成功的关键在于用户需求的精准把握与产品设计的用户中心理念。
#### 成功背后的因素在分析这一成功案例时,我们会发现其在市场营销上也颇具手腕,通过社交媒体快速传播与用户口碑的积累,进一步推动了钱包的下载与使用。
### 常见问题与解决方案 #### 安全性问题安全性是一切问题的重中之重。在开发阶段,务必融入最新的安全协议与防护机制,确保每一笔交易都能被有效验证。
#### 启动问题部分初学者可能会在启动过程中遇到环境不匹配或依赖库丢失等问题。推荐详细查阅项目文档,并核对每一步骤,以求解决。
#### 用户体验问题在用户体验方面,持续收集用户反馈,进行定期的更新与迭代,至关重要。通过数据分析找到用户使用痛点,持续界面和功能。
### 总结通过H5区块链钱包源码的搭建,开发者可以轻松创建高效、易用的资产管理工具,迎接数字货币时代的挑战。未来,随着区块链技术的发展,我们相信H5区块链钱包会迎来更多的机遇与挑战,值得各位开发者去探索与尝试。
--- ### 相关问题讨论 1. H5区块链钱包的安全性如何保障? 2. 如何提升用户体验? 3. 针对不同用户需求,H5钱包可以有哪些扩展功能? 4. H5区块链钱包的市场前景如何? 5. 数据隐私如何保护? 6. H5开发的优势与劣势是什么? (由于字数限制,无法逐个问题详细展开,如需详细信息,请告知)2003-2026 tp官方正版 @版权所有 |网站地图|桂ICP备2022008651号-1